In the South, we are known for our great food. From crawfish to jambalaya, to seafood gumbo, we know how to cook and eat. Eating is a great form of entertainment and cooks scramble to find the latest and best recipes. Here is a great recipe for a growing church:


First, we need to evangelize by looking for opportunities to tell others about New Testament Christianity (Matthew 28:18-20). All may not be teachers, but we can invite others to our services and events. Remember, eighty-eight per cent of visitors come to an assembly because someone cared enough to invite them.


Second, we must be hospitable to our visitors and our members. We greet our visitors and help them to feel at home. We answer any questions they may have and show them where the age-appropriate Bible classes are. We encourage them to visit again and invite them to lunch. Our visitors need to know we appreciate them, and we are here to help.


Third, we must obey the Lord’s command, “A new commandment I give to you, that you love one another; as I have loved you, that you also love one another.


By this all will know that you are My disciples, if you have love for one another” (John 13:34,35). Christians love each other by serving one another. From bringing meals in sick-ness and in sorrow, to flowers or presents for new arrivals, we are there for one another. Love is looking for ways to serve and putting others ahead of ourselves.


Friends, let us evangelize and invite, let us demonstrate hospitality, and let us always love one another in good times and in bad times. The world is watching. Let us show Jesus to them.
